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/75.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Html 我能';t将按钮放置在我的图像中_Html_Css - Fatal编程技术网

Html 我能';t将按钮放置在我的图像中

Html 我能';t将按钮放置在我的图像中,html,css,Html,Css,基本上,我想将按钮放置在图像中,并在切换到移动模式或更改窗口大小时使其保持在原来的位置 这就是我希望它看起来的样子: .img包装器{ 位置:相对位置; } .img响应{ 最大宽度:100%; 高度:自动; 边缘顶部:180像素; 左边距:360px; } a、 btn{ 显示:内联块; 填充物:0.2em 1.45em; 边缘:0.1米; 边框:0.15em实心#中交; 框大小:边框框; 文字装饰:无; 字体系列:“SegoeUI”,“Roboto”,无衬线; 字体大小:400; 颜色

基本上,我想将按钮放置在图像中,并在切换到移动模式或更改窗口大小时使其保持在原来的位置

这就是我希望它看起来的样子:

.img包装器{
位置:相对位置;
}
.img响应{
最大宽度:100%;
高度:自动;
边缘顶部:180像素;
左边距:360px;
}
a、 btn{
显示:内联块;
填充物:0.2em 1.45em;
边缘:0.1米;
边框:0.15em实心#中交;
框大小:边框框;
文字装饰:无;
字体系列:“SegoeUI”,“Roboto”,无衬线;
字体大小:400;
颜色:#000000;
背景色:#ffc966;
文本对齐:居中;
位置:相对位置;
}
a、 btn:悬停{
边框颜色:#7a7a;
}
a、 btn:活动{
背景色:#999999;
}
@全部和全部介质(最大宽度:30em){
a、 btn{
显示:块;
保证金:0.2米自动;
}
}

De zakelijke VR/AR硬件leverancier van Benelux
(我提前发布..不小心按下了发布按钮)。。。您没有img或H1的css。。我添加了一些,我还为主css和响应(媒体)css中的图像添加了最大宽度。 该代码可以做一些调整,但我建议你看看,并适应你的需要。我想这更接近你想要的

编辑:我建议您添加更多的媒体查询,以适应不同的屏幕分辨率,因为在不同大小的设备上,绝对定位可能有点像噩梦。是一个很好的工具,用于测试代码在多种大小上的外观。使用以像素为单位的大边距底部(如360px)可能会导致按钮甚至无法在屏幕上显示,因此在测量高度时,请尝试使用垂直高度(vh)或百分比。[calc函数]也非常有用。用于居中的有用css有
边距:0自动
文本对齐:居中

祝你好运,希望这对你有所帮助

h1{
文本对齐:居中;
字体大小:粗体;
字号:1.8em;
}
img{
最大宽度:70%;
最高高度:80%;
利润率:10px 12%;
}
img包装器{
显示:内联块;
位置:相对位置;
}
导航{
保证金:0自动;
}
导航ul{
列表样式类型:无;
背景颜色:浅灰色;
宽度:100%;
}
李国荣{
最小宽度:18%;
显示:内联块;
文本对齐:居中;
填充:10px;
保证金:0自动;
}
ullia{
填充:10px 15px;
文字装饰:无;
}
/*.img响应{
/*边缘顶部:100px;
左边距:360px;
}*/
a、 btn{
显示:内联块;
填充物:0.2em 1.45em;
边缘:0.1米;
边框:0.15em实心#中交;
框大小:边框框;
文字装饰:无;
字体系列:“SegoeUI”,“Roboto”,无衬线;
字体大小:400;
颜色:#000000;
背景色:#ffc966;
文本对齐:居中;
位置:相对位置;
}
a、 btn:悬停{
边框颜色:#7a7a;
}
a、 btn:活动{
背景色:#999999;
}
@全部和全部介质(最大宽度:30em){
img{
最大宽度:400px;
}
a、 btn{
显示:块;
保证金:0.2米自动;
}
}
De zakelijke VR/AR硬件leverancier van Benelux
(我提前发布..不小心按下了发布按钮)。。。您没有img或H1的css。。我添加了一些,我还为主css和响应(媒体)css中的图像添加了最大宽度。 该代码可以做一些调整,但我建议你看看,并适应你的需要。我想这更接近你想要的

编辑:我建议您添加更多的媒体查询,以适应不同的屏幕分辨率,因为在不同大小的设备上,绝对定位可能有点像噩梦。是一个很好的工具,用于测试代码在多种大小上的外观。使用以像素为单位的大边距底部(如360px)可能会导致按钮甚至无法在屏幕上显示,因此在测量高度时,请尝试使用垂直高度(vh)或百分比。[calc函数]也非常有用。用于居中的有用css有
边距:0自动
文本对齐:居中

祝你好运,希望这对你有所帮助

h1{
文本对齐:居中;
字体大小:粗体;
字号:1.8em;
}
img{
最大宽度:70%;
最高高度:80%;
利润率:10px 12%;
}
img包装器{
显示:内联块;
位置:相对位置;
}
导航{
保证金:0自动;
}
导航ul{
列表样式类型:无;
背景颜色:浅灰色;
宽度:100%;
}
李国荣{
最小宽度:18%;
显示:内联块;
文本对齐:居中;
填充:10px;
保证金:0自动;
}
ullia{
填充:10px 15px;
文字装饰:无;
}
/*.img响应{
/*边缘顶部:100px;
左边距:360px;
}*/
a、 btn{
显示:内联块;
填充物:0.2em 1.45em;
边缘:0.1米;
边框:0.15em实心#中交;
框大小:边框框;
文字装饰:无;
字体系列:“SegoeUI”,“Roboto”,无衬线;
字体大小:400;
颜色:#000000;
背景色:#ffc966;
文本对齐:居中;
位置:相对位置;
}
a、 btn:悬停{
边框颜色:#7a7a;
}
a、 btn:活动{
背景色:#999999;
}
@全部和全部介质(最大宽度:30em){
img{
最大宽度:400px;
}
a、 btn{
显示:块;
保证金:0.2米自动;
}
}
De zakelijke VR/AR硬件leverancier van Benelux

按钮相对于其第一个父元素的位置应为绝对位置

a.btn 
{
    position: absolute;
    top: 50%;
    left: 50%;
}
.img包装器{
位置:相对位置;
}
a、 btn{
位置:绝对位置;
最高:50%;
左:50%;
填充物:0.2em 1.45em;
边缘:0.1米;
边框:0.15em实心#中交;
框大小:边框框;
文字装饰:无;
字体系列:“SegoeUI”,“Roboto”,无衬线;
字体大小:400;
颜色:#000000;
背景色:#ffc966;
文本对齐:居中;
}
a、 btn:悬停{
边框颜色:#7a7a;
}
a、 btn:活动{
背景色